Ebay decorating is like treasure hunting

Capture exactly the item you need to complete your creative decorating scheme

It helps to have some ideas thought out ahead when you are planning an eBay decorating project. Follow the same rules and game plan as you would when shopping in a regular store. Have your measurements, colors, ideas etc. handy in your Portable Home Decorating Portfolio

If you are searching for a green banker"s lamp for your home office desk, don't get sidetracked into looking at those cute frilly bedroom lamps. Focus on your project. By all means cruise and window shop to your heart's content, but remember your mission.

How much should I bid for this eBay decorating item?

This is always a tough call. I guess my answer would be, "How much is the item really worth to you?" Here are some general guidelines:

  • Is this the first item you've found on your search? If so, mark it in "My EBay" and keep looking. You may find something you like better.

  • Is this an item you'd like to have but are not really crazy about? See above comment

  • Is this something you really like, fits into your plan, and you have exactly the right place to put it? Jump into the bidding and see if you can get it for a reasonable amount.

  • Is this something you absolutely love, can't find anywhere else, and don't want to live without? If it is a "buy now" item, grab it. If you have to go through the bid process, decide on your highest price and add 20% to it if you must. Even if you are paying more than you feel it is worth, if it's a great item it will increase in value. Even if it doesn't, if it is a "must have" item, you will enjoy it for many years to come. For that reason alone, it is worth paying over the perceived value for the item.

If you are bidding on a "must have" be sure to set "Alerts" under the Tools section so that you get phone notification when you are outbidded.

EBay decorating ideas for various home decorating styles

Below is a listing of items you could consider buying for your eBay decorating scheme:

Traditional Style Decorating

  • leaded glass crystal
  • Wedgewood china
  • pictures of foxhunts, horses, and watercolor landscapes
  • Chinese screens
  • tufted or needlepoint footstools
  • silver tea service

Federal/Colonial Style Decorating

  • wall tapestries
  • any items with American eagles
  • ginger jars
  • embroidery samplers
  • pewter items
  • fireplace accessories

Country Style Decorating

  • quilts and quilt racks
  • kitchen items such as butter churns and tin cookie molds
  • stoneware and pottery bowls
  • rag rugs
  • kerosene lamps
  • blue or white enamel coffeepot
Victorian Style Decorating
  • umbrella stands
  • tassels
  • vintage linens
  • piano shawls and tablecloths
  • large vases and floral arrangements
  • Dresden figurines
  • ormolu clocks
  • ornate picture frames

Garden Style Decorating

  • wicker furniture
  • bird houses and bird cages
  • plant pots and plant containers
  • floral arrangements
  • botanical and garden prints
  • hammocks and swinging chairs
  • trellises and picket fences
  • antique garden tools
  • fruit packing crates with original labels

ebay decorating Southwestern Style Decorating
  • Indian arts and crafts items such as baskets and jewelry
  • Indian woven rugs and baskets
  • Kachina dolls
  • Mexican hats and serapes
  • Cattle skulls and longhorns
  • totem poles
  • dream catchers
  • drums
  • Remington sculptures
  • Ansel Adams prints
  • Antique guns

Log Cabin/Adirondack Style Decorating

  • log and twig furniture
  • fishing creels
  • canoe paddles
  • wildlife pictures
  • blue enamel pots
  • kerosene lamps
  • duck decoys
  • Pendelton blankets
  • back packs
  • fireplace tools

Asian/Oriental Style Decorating

  • shoji screens
  • tatami mats
  • ginger jars
  • items made of porcelain and jade
  • Japanese fans
  • Japanese lanterns
  • paper umbrellas
  • calligraphy wall hangings
